Tar and gravel roof services encompass a range of maintenance, repair, and installation tasks aimed at ensuring the durability and performance of this traditional roofing system. These services often involve inspecting the roof for signs of damage or wear, replacing or repairing loose or deteriorated gravel, and applying new layers of asphalt and gravel to restore the roof’s protective barrier. Proper maintenance can help prolong the lifespan of a tar and gravel roof, which is known for its robustness and affordability. Local contractors specializing in these services are equipped to address issues that may compromise the roof’s integrity, such as cracks, blisters, or areas of ponding water.

One common problem that tar and gravel roof services help resolve is the development of leaks, often caused by aging materials, weather-related damage, or improper installation. Over time, the gravel layer can shift or become thin, exposing the underlying asphalt membrane to the elements. This exposure can lead to water infiltration, which may cause interior damage and mold growth if left unaddressed. Service providers can perform patch repairs, resealing, or complete overlay applications to prevent leaks and maintain the roof’s waterproofing capabilities. Regular inspections and timely repairs are essential for addressing these issues before they escalate into more significant problems.

Properties that typically utilize tar and gravel roof services include commercial buildings, industrial facilities, and some residential structures, especially those with flat or low-slope roofs. These roofs are valued for their durability, ease of repair, and ability to withstand harsh weather conditions. Commercial warehouses, office complexes, and multi-family housing units often rely on tar and gravel roofing systems due to their cost-effectiveness and long track record of performance. The overview below groups typical Tar And Gravel Roof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Chatham, NJ.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Cost of Tar and Gravel Roof Service - Typical expenses for tar and gravel roof services range from $1,500 to $4,500, depending on the size and complexity of the roof. Small repairs may cost closer to $500, while full replacements can exceed $6,000 in some cases.

Average Repair Costs - Minor patching or sealing repairs generally fall between $200 and $800. Larger repairs, such as replacing sections of gravel or patching extensive damage, tend to cost between $1,000 and $2,500.

Installation Expenses - The cost to install a new tar and gravel roof typically ranges from $4,000 to $10,000 for an average-sized residential roof. Costs can vary based on roof size, pitch, and accessibility, with larger or more complex roofs reaching higher price points.

Maintenance and Inspection Fees - Routine inspections and minor maintenance services often cost between $150 and $400. These services help identify potential issues early and prolong the lifespan of the roofing system.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the benefits of a tar and gravel roof? Tar and gravel roofs provide durability, weather resistance, and a relatively low-cost roofing option for flat or low-slope structures.

How often should a tar and gravel roof be inspected? Regular inspections are recommended at least once a year to identify potential issues early and maintain roof integrity.

What maintenance is needed for a tar and gravel roof? Maintenance typically includes removing debris, inspecting for cracks or damage, and ensuring gravel coverage remains even.

Can a tar and gravel roof be repaired? Yes, local roofing professionals can perform repairs to address leaks, cracks, or damage to extend the roof’s lifespan.

When should a tar and gravel roof be replaced? Replacement is usually considered when repairs become frequent or the roof shows signs of significant deterioration and aging.
